The Cannoneers hosted the Twins of Columbia-Greene on Sunday, and it was once again a tale of two halves. The Cannoneers were ice-cold in the first half and only managed 18 points. The second half would be a different story as the Cannoneers would outscore the Twins but couldn't make up the difference in losing by the final score of 72-62. The Cannoneers would be without the services of Machi Plummer and Kristan Lewis would lead the way with a big-game double/double of 19 points/13 rebounds. Sheldon Jean-Baptiste would also chip in with his best game of the season with 14 points and Shamell Ponds would add 13 points as well. DMair Williams would also have a solid game with 4 points and 9 rebounds. Next up is the conference match-up with Cayuga on Wednesday night in Auburn, NY.
